About The Position

Compass Government Solutions is seeking experienced Registered Nurses (RNs) to support the Emergency Department (ED) and Transfer Center at Naval Medical Center Portsmouth, which provide 24/7 emergency and trauma care to active-duty service members, retirees, and their families. Emergency Department RNs play a critical role in delivering high-quality, patient-centered care in a fast-paced clinical environment while collaborating with a multidisciplinary healthcare team. This opportunity is part of a proposal effort. We are currently accepting applications from experienced candidates to be considered if the contract is awarded. Incumbents are encouraged to apply. Work Schedule: Eight (8) hour schedule, Monday through Friday, 0730–1630 Alternative work schedules may be implemented, including compressed schedules (e.g., 8–10 hour shifts, 4–5 shifts per week) Work hours shall not exceed 40 hours per week and not exceed 80 hours per two-week period

Requirements

  •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N)
  • Graduate from a college or university nursing program accredited by the National League for Nursing Accrediting Commission (NLNAC) or the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E)
  • OR
  • Graduate from:
  • A state-accredited professional nursing program, or
  • A nursing program accredited by the Accreditation Commission for Education in Nursing (ACEN) or the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E)
  • Minimum of one (1) year of experience in emergency nursing
  • Current, full, active, and unrestricted Registered Nurse (RN) license from any U.S. state or territory
  • Advanced Cardiac Life Support (ACLS)
  • Pediatric Advanced Life Support (PALS)
  • Trauma Nurse Core Course (TNCC)
  • and/or
  • Advanced Trauma Care for Nurses (ATCN)

Responsibilities

  • Provide emergency nursing care in collaboration with physicians, advanced practice providers, and interdisciplinary healthcare teams
  • Perform patient assessments, obtain health histories, and deliver timely clinical interventions
  • Administer medications, provide wound and trauma care, and deliver other individualized nursing treatments
  • Recognize and respond rapidly to changes in patient condition and emergency situations
  • Coordinate patient care, referrals, and specialty services as appropriate
  • Supervise and clinically direct assigned support staff in accordance with scope of practice
  • Educate patients and families to support treatment plans and health outcomes
  • Ensure compliance with applicable standards of care, clinical practice guidelines, and MTF policies
  • Maintain productivity comparable to peers performing similar services
  • Comply with infection control, safety, and risk management requirements
  • Participate in peer review, performance improvement, and quality assurance activities
  • Complete all required MTF and DoD annual training
  • Participate in meetings, in-service training, and clinical support activities as directed
  • Perform timely, accurate, and complete documentation using authorized clinical systems (e.g., MHS GENESIS)
  • Maintain professional accountability, licensure, and required certifications
